The best pool in Mara and one of the best in the area. The prices are medium but the view definetly makes up for it. The pool is very clean although it is rather small. They have parking places right at the property but the road is rather steep. They have a large variety of beverages you can have over there
The music is pretty loud but you get used to it. In the weekends during the summer time it can get rather crowded but during the weekdays it is ok. It is definetly a thing to check out if you are in Marsmures and you want a dip.
